About the role

Bloom Growth is hiring a Senior Human Resources Generalist to support our fully remote team and ensure a smooth, consistent, and positive employee experience. You’ll be the primary HR partner for employees and managers, running the daily HR operations that keep our people processes working seamlessly. If you love helping people, enjoy organized workflows, and take pride in accuracy and follow-through, this role is for you.


What you'll do

  • Manage full-cycle recruiting and candidate coordination.
  • Lead onboarding and offboarding activities.
  • Maintain HRIS data, employee files, and documentation accuracy.
  • Administer benefits and support employee inquiries.
  • Provide first-line employee relations support and escalate when needed.
  • Process U.S. and international payroll accurately and on time.
  • Support compliance tasks (unemployment, EEO-1, salary surveys).
  • Lead the Culture Committee and contribute to internal communications.
  • Maintain HR dashboards and support ongoing HR projects.

Qualifications


Required:

  • Bachelor’s degree in HR, Business Administration, or related field
  • 5–7 years of HR generalist experience
  • Payroll processing experience (U.S.; international a plus)
  • Strong knowledge of HR operations, benefits, and onboarding
  • Excellent written and verbal communication
  • High attention to detail, organization, and follow-through
  • Comfortable working in a fully remote environment

Preferred:

  • SHRM-CP or PHR certification
  • Experience in SaaS or remote-first environments
  • HRIS administration experience in Rippling
  • Experience with a growth operating system like Bloom Growth, EOS, Scaling Up, or Pinnacle
Compensation

The expected salary range for this role is $80,000–$100,000 USD, depending on experience, skills, qualifications, and geographic location. Bloom Growth™ follows an equitable, market-aligned compensation philosophy to ensure fairness and consistency across our fully remote team.

What you need to know about the Boston Tech Scene

Boston is a powerhouse for technology innovation thanks to world-class research universities like MIT and Harvard and a robust pipeline of venture capital investment. Host to the first telephone call and one of the first general-purpose computers ever put into use, Boston is now a hub for biotechnology, robotics and artificial intelligence — though it’s also home to several B2B software giants. So it’s no surprise that the city consistently ranks among the greatest startup ecosystems in the world.

Key Facts About Boston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 269,000; 9.4%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Thermo Fisher Scientific, Toast, Klaviyo, HubSpot, DraftKings
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, biotechnology, robotics, software, aerospace
  • Funding Landscape: $15.7 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Summit Partners, Volition Capital, Bain Capital Ventures, MassVentures, Highland Capital Partners
  • Research Centers and Universities: MIT, Harvard University, Boston College, Tufts University, Boston University, Northeastern University, Smithsonian Astrophysical Observatory, National Bureau of Economic Research, Broad Institute, Lowell Center for Space Science & Technology, National Emerging Infectious Diseases Laboratories
